啊哈算法
⑴ 算法2 伟大思维闪耀时 什么时候出版
额,我想你说的《数据结构与算法分析》应该是Weiss写的那本吧,那本书豆瓣给出了9分的评分,已经算是非常高的分数了,但计算机世界的经典着作犹如浩瀚的海洋,了不起的编程书籍还有很多。
⑵ 跪求完整版《啊哈C语言》 不要那个只有200页的三章不完整版那个我有了
我有!⑶ 求《啊哈算法》PDF
您好,以下是下载的地方,希望喜欢,谢谢!
⑷ 除了啊哈算法还有别的好的算法书吗要有电子版的
算法导论,啊哈算法没有看过
⑸ 请问有:啊哈!算法 这本书的PDF完全版吗谢谢!
亲,手机用户部分网址不可见=转到电脑即可,如可见复制网址到浏览器即可下载
资源已光速上传网络云,请尽快查收吧。
若满意请【采纳】呦!有疑问请及时追问。
亲请放心下载,附件下载的财富值只针对其他童鞋,
提问者无需再支付财富值了哟,么么哒!
⑹ 学习算法有什么入门级的书 或者学习资料。(英语不太好)
《啊哈!算法》
这本书最大的两点就是生动有趣,算法如此枯燥的理论都能在这本书里找到轻松愉悦的讲解,并且此书非常切实,一切都以实际应用出发,阅读中更像是在看故事书或者再玩解谜类游戏。可以在愉快地氛围中,找到自己的需要学习的部分,让学习也可以变得更简单。
《算法问题实战策略》
这本书被誉为韩国史上最棒的算法实战书,就像书名一样,全书更侧重于实际应用,本书可以让读者学到更精妙的算法结构和设计的技巧,进而提升读者的在生活中的算法问题解决能力。
《挑战程序设计竞赛》
这本书主要是针对程序设计竞赛的题目,全书对题目进行了非常细致的讲解,并且汇总了经典题目和基础算法,根据自身的等级可以选择初、中、高的篇目。由浅入深、由简入繁的讲解非常细致,也介绍了许多的实战技巧。
⑺ 怎么在dos系统上做一个两位数的四则运算的计算器啊哈⊙_⊙
不知道你的DOS是什么样的环境,纯DOS里有计算器嘛.如果是WINDOWS里的DOS环境.那的计算器文件是calc.exe直接在BAT里执行CALC.EXE文件就行了[email protected]
⑻ 如何用啊哈c编程加法计算器
这里的同步千万不要理解成那个同时进行,应是指协同、协助、互相配合。
线程同步是指多线程通过特定的设置(如互斥量,事件对象,临界区)来控制线程之间的执行顺序(即所谓的同步)也可以说是在线程之间通过同步建立起执行顺序的关系,如果没有同步,那线程之间是各自运行各自的!
⑼ 《啊哈!算法》epub下载在线阅读,求百度网盘云资源
《啊哈!算法》(啊哈磊)电子书网盘下载免费在线阅读
链接:
书名:啊哈!算法
作者:啊哈磊
豆瓣评分:7.7
出版社:人民邮电出版社
出版年份:2014-6-1
页数:246
内容简介:
这不过是一本有趣的算法书而已。和别的算法书比较,如果硬要说它有什么特点的话,那就是你能看懂它。
这是一本充满智慧和趣味的算法入门书。没有枯燥的描述,没有难懂的公式,一切以实际应用为出发点,
通过幽默的语言配以可爱的插图来讲解算法。你更像是在阅读一个个轻松的小故事或是在玩一把趣味解谜
游戏,在轻松愉悦中便掌握算法精髓,感受算法之美。
本书中涉及到的数据结构有栈、队列、链表、树、并查集、堆和图等;涉及到的算法有排序、枚举、
深度和广度优先搜索、图的遍历,当然还有图论中不可以缺少的四种最短路径算法、两种最小生成树算法、
割点与割边算法、二分图的最大匹配算法等。
网名啊哈磊。
曾在中科院玩过单片机。武汉大学历史上第一位以本科生身份加入MSRA(微软亚洲研究院)的小伙伴,在机器学习组从事搜索引擎方面的研究。
发表国际会议论文一篇(IEEE)。
全国青少年信息学奥林匹克金牌教练。
超萌超简洁的C语言编译器——“啊哈C编译器”作者。
2013年我的着作,有趣的编程科普书《啊哈C!》出版。
网址:www.ahalei.com
微博:weibo.com/ahalei
非常喜欢小朋友,每天都过得都非常开心。
至于为什么叫“啊哈磊”,因为我觉得这是一个很喜庆的名字。
作者简介:
网名啊哈磊。
曾在中科院玩过单片机。武汉大学历史上第一位以本科生身份加入MSRA(微软亚洲研究院)的小伙伴,在机器学习组从事搜索引擎方面的研究。
发表国际会议论文一篇(IEEE)。
全国青少年信息学奥林匹克金牌教练。
超萌超简洁的C语言编译器——“啊哈C编译器”作者。
2013年我的着作,有趣的编程科普书《啊哈C!》出版。
⑽ 关于深度优先算法——数的全排列 C语言
我的G++编译器上一切正常,是不是数组太小输入的数越界了,第一个return可以不写,只要把后面循环部分放在if的else部分里即可达到和return一样效果
book[i]这个数组记录的是当前i处的数字有没有用过,因为全排列是全不重复的
当DFS时,判断当前循环变量所代表的数字有没有在排列中出现,已经出现,就跳过(防止出现5 5 5 5 5 之类情况)
如果没有出现过,把这位数字压入排列,这位数字的book[i]赋值为1,代表用过,然后dfs下一位,然后再清除book[i],这是一个回溯的过程,因为 for(i=1;i<=n;i++) 这个循环会遍历所有可能取的数,不能因为第一种情况取了5 1 循环到2的时候 5 2 这种情况下 1 还是被使用 , 所以显然要清掉1的使用, 这两种情况是相互并列, 结论是 这种回溯的过程一般在DFS之后进行 , 清除这一次DFS对整体状态的影响,让函数回到这一次调用DFS之前的状态